Godrej Properties Expands Footprint in Bengaluru: Acquires 4-Acre Land for Premium Housing Project

Godrej Properties, a prominent player in the Indian real estate sector, has announced the acquisition of a 4-acre land parcel in Yeshwanthpur, Bengaluru, signaling its intent to develop a luxury housing project. The realty firm envisions a substantial revenue of Rs 1,000 crore through the sale of premium residential apartments in this prime location along National Highway – 75.

The company, in a regulatory filing, revealed that the project’s estimated developable potential is around 0.7 million square feet of saleable area, primarily comprising upscale residential units. Godrej Properties expressed confidence in the venture, projecting the revenue potential to reach Rs 1,250 crore with the addition of an extra acre of land, making it a 5-acre parcel.

Gaurav Pandey, MD & CEO of Godrej Properties, emphasized the significance of Yeshwanthpur as a crucial micro-market for the company. He stated, “We are happy to add this land parcel to our portfolio,” underlining the strategic importance of the acquisition in strengthening the company’s presence in Bengaluru.

Godrej Properties, part of the esteemed Godrej Group, has set ambitious targets for land acquisitions in the current fiscal year, aiming to generate approximately Rs 15,000 crore in revenue post-development. Last fiscal year, the company acquired 18 new land parcels with a sales potential of Rs 32,000 crore post-development, showcasing its aggressive approach in the real estate market.

The realty giant’s focus on key markets such as Delhi-NCR, Mumbai Metropolitan Region (MMR), Bengaluru, and Pune has been integral to its growth strategy. Despite the challenges posed by the real estate sector, Godrej Properties remains optimistic about meeting its sales target of Rs 14,000 crore for the current fiscal year, riding on the strong demand for its ongoing and upcoming housing projects.

In the April-September period of 2023-24, the company has already achieved a remarkable 48% growth in sales bookings, reaching Rs 7,288 crore compared to Rs 4,929 crore in the corresponding period of the previous year.
